    <p>On September 12, UMBC’s <strong><a href="https://cbee.umbc.edu/upal-ghosh/" rel="nofollow external" class="bo">Upal Ghosh</a></strong>, from the Department of Chemical, Biochemical, and Environmental Engineering, was sworn in as a member of the Washington, D.C., mayor’s Leadership Council for a Cleaner Anacostia River (LCCAR). The council consists of 25 high-level government officials, community leaders, and environmental experts who support the vision of a swimmable and fishable Anacostia River. The members meet quarterly to advise the D.C. government on ongoing restoration projects. </p>
    <p>The Anacostia River, which runs from Prince George’s County in Maryland into Washington, D.C., before joining the Potomac River and ultimately flowing into the Chesapeake Bay, has historically suffered from high levels of industrial pollution and contamination from sewage overflow. In recent years, government officials have been making concerted efforts to clean up the river. UMBC was invited to sit on the council, with Ghosh as the representative, based on the university’s key contributions to these clean-up efforts. </p>

    <p><br>Since 2016, Ghosh and his UMBC colleagues and students have developed innovative methods of measuring contaminants in the river and created models to elucidate where the contaminants come from and how they travel through and accumulate in the water, sediment, and aquatic life, such as fish. <strong><a href="https://imet.usmd.edu/directory/nathalie-lombard" rel="nofollow external" class="bo">Nathalie Lombard</a></strong>, a research assistant professor at UMBC who has played a significant role in the projects, will serve as the alternate representative on the LLCAR when Ghosh cannot attend. </p>
    <p><br>In addition to his work on the Anacostia, Ghosh and his students have studied and contributed to the cleanup of the <a href="https://factor.niehs.nih.gov/2024/9/feature/4-feature-innovative-environmental-remediation" rel="nofollow external" class="bo">waterways throughout Maryland, Delaware, and across the country</a>. “Students learn a lot from being out in the field,” Ghosh says. “They learn how the science and engineering we do helps guide major decisions. Our ultimate goal is making a positive difference in the health of the river, lake, or bay. That gives me a lot of excitement, and it really motivates the students too.”</p>

    <div class="html-content"><div><div><strong>Excerpt from "Preparing for impact: Four new UMBC grads share what drives their research"</strong></div><div><strong><br></strong></div><div><strong>DECEMBER 17, 2019 |  SARAH HANSEN</strong></div></div><div><br></div><div>It’s 3 a.m., and <strong>Cindy Chelius</strong> rolls out of the pull-out couch in the grad student lounge. Time to check on her fungi. For this experiment, measurements must be taken every four hours for forty hours. Thankfully, the undergraduates she mentors took the day shift. Tonight, as the lead on the project, it’s her turn.</div><div><br></div><div>“I think it just makes you feel like you really earned it when those results come back,” Chelius says. She <em>has </em>earned it—on December 18, she’ll walk across the stage to receive her Ph.D. in chemical and biochemical engineering from UMBC. The signaling pathways of fungi might seem like niche research, but fungal species are commonly used in industry as tiny, living factories. They can produce substances found in an array of products, including medications.</div><div><br></div><div><div>After graduation, Chelius will take her skills to Bristol-Myers Squibb’s upstream processing development team in Devens, Massachusetts. She’ll help the company improve the ways they use organisms to produce therapeutic compounds. </div><div><br></div><div>Chelius’s UMBC experience has prepared her well for a research career in ways that go beyond a successful dissertation. Encouraged by her Ph.D. advisor, <strong>Mark Marten</strong>, professor and chair of chemical, biochemical, and environmental engineering, Chelius learned how to use bioreactors. “These industry positions really like someone coming in with that working knowledge,” she explains.</div><div><br></div><div><div>Chelius also took advantage of the Biochemical Regulatory Certification program at UMBC, organized by <strong>Tony Moreira</strong>, vice provost for academic affairs. It’s a four-course series including training in FDA regulations and good manufacturing practices, local lab tours, and more. “I think it really helped with my job interviews, because I was able to understand the acronyms they were talking about and reference the literature on these topics,” Chelius says.</div><div><br></div><div>She’s also expanded her cultural awareness by being active in a dynamic, diverse department with students and faculty from across the U.S. and the world.     <div class="html-content"><p>Erick Gutierrez was selected as the recipient of the <strong>Young Professionals Award in Upstream and Downstream Processing</strong> for his poster “Microscale Chromatography toolkits for rapid screening and purification of therapeutic proteins” presented at the 2019 Orlando Meeting. </p>
    
    <p>This award recognizes excellence by a non-student member of the BIOT 3M Separation and Purification Sciences Division and ACS-BIOT (American Chemical Society’s Division of Biochemical Technology) for Young Professionals in Upstream &amp; Downstream Processing. This award is given to professionals 35 years of age or younger who present outstanding research in upstream and downstream processing at the poster session as part of the Division of Biochemical Technology (BIOT) programming at the ACS annual meeting.  The 3M Company is the sponsor for this award.</p>
    
    <p> The 2019 BIOT Award for Young Professionals in Upstream &amp; Downstream Processing will be awarded as part of 2020 Spring National Meeting, in Philadelphia, PA from March 22 - 26.</p>
    
    <h4>Research Overview: </h4><div><strong>Introduction: </strong></div><div>We report versatile, customizable, robust, low-cost, and easily manufacturable chromatography micro-columns (μCols) made using  thermoplastic solvent bonding and used for rapid screening of therapeutic quality protein purification. We compared granulocyte-colony stimulating factor (GCSF) protein purification, expressed using a cell-free CHO in-vitro translation (IVT) system, between a conventional 1mL immobilized metal affinity chromatography (IMAC) column and the fabricated μCols ranging from 25 μL to 200 μL. Experimental data revealed comparable purity with a 10-fold reduction in the amount of buffer, resin, and purification time for the μCols, with an 80% reduction of cost. </div><div><br></div><div><strong>Objective: </strong></div><div>Provide an alternative and innovative solution for quick prototyping of μCols for process development and optimization for affinity-based purification.</div><div><br></div><div><a href="https://my3.my.umbc.edu/system/shared/attachments/b29c196bbbc5ef21c7130a9d8dd3f1c8/60fec05f/news/000/088/047/5282e962ed024c738ce3e1e2b0a247ec/ACS%20Poster%20Final.pdf?1572533427" rel="nofollow external" class="bo">View Full Poster</a></div><div><br></div>

    <p>Erick graduated from UMBC with a Bachelor's degree in Chemical Engineering (’18).  He worked at Center for Advanced Sensor Technology (<a href="https://cast.umbc.edu/" rel="nofollow external" class="bo">CAST</a>) located in UMBC, as a Systems Design Engineer focused on the product development of microfluidic devices used for downstream processing of therapeutic proteins.</p>
    
    <p>He began his career in microfluidics by working as the team leader of an undergraduate team in Dr. Govind Rao's sensors class, tasked with developing a microfluidic debubbler for his <a href="https://cast.umbc.edu/biological-medicines-on-demand-bio-mod/" rel="nofollow external" class="bo">Bio-MOD project</a> funded by DARPA. He was then offered an internship position in the systems design team of the Bio-MOD project under the mentorship of Dr. Abhay Andar, where he was tasked with optimizing and making the bioprocesses used for the G-CSF purification runs, as well as developing, manufacturing, and validating microfluidic devices for downstream processing.</p>
    
    <p>Upon graduation, he was offered a full-time position as a Research Associate in the Bio-MOD project, joining for the second phase of the project in which we had to optimize our process for animal studies. We developed several microfluidic devices, such as mixers, holders, novel and fully customizable chromatography micro-columns (µcols), and multi-functional integrated chips using thermo-plastic solvent bonding methods and adhesives. Our work for "Low‐cost customizable microscale toolkit for rapid screening and purification of therapeutic proteins," was recently published. (<a href="https://doi.org/10.1002/bit.26876" rel="nofollow external" class="bo">https://doi.org/10.1002/bit.26876</a>) We further expanded our microfluidics research by using wood instead of plastics as our primary material, which led to the publication of “Wood Microfluidics,” published in Analytical Chemistry in 2019. </p></div>
